Promtail json example. md 需要注意截至到2. Usage example: Hey @sdeoras If you look closer, y...
Promtail json example. md 需要注意截至到2. Usage example: Hey @sdeoras If you look closer, you’ll see your log message is prefixed with stdout F. JSON parsing at query can be slow and can consume a lot of I have multiline log that consists correct json part (one or more lines), and after it - stack trace. Parsing stages: docker: Extract data by parsing the log line using the standard Docker This example of config promtail based on original docker config and show how work with 2 and more sources: Filename for example: my-docker-config. yaml) which contains information on the Promtail server, where positions are stored, and Embed Download ZIP [promtail使用样例] promtail json日志样例配置 #config #example Raw promtail-config. You can find migration resources here. This library supports both JSON and Protobuf APIs. Promtail is an agent for Loki logging system. A comprehensive guide to parsing JSON logs with Promtail for Grafana Loki, covering JSON extraction, nested fields, timestamp handling, and best practices for structured log processing. GitHub Gist: instantly share code, notes, and snippets. You should run your logs through the cri pipeline stage (docs) before attempting to parse the JSON. This stage uses the Go JSON unmarshaler, which means non-string types like numbers or booleans will be unmarshaled The timestamp and metadata in front of the JSON object is preventing it from being parsed properly. I've tried the setup of Promtail with Java SpringBoot applications (which generates logs to file in JSON format by Logstash logback encoder) and it works. Example for Promtail json pipeline deployed with loki-stack #9480 Have a question about this project? Sign up for a free GitHub account to open Promtail Configuration Introduction Promtail is a log collection agent designed to work seamlessly with Grafana Loki. Parsing stages: docker: Extract data by parsing the log line using the standard Docker . I am having an issue with getting promtail to read and log file and extract the infomation i need to send to loki The log line in the file looks like this 2022-11-16T16:55:35. If a discovered target has decompression configured, Promtail The 'json' Promtail pipeline stage. 738757+00:00 In this case the JSON with log fields is stored as a string in the _msg field , so later it could be parsed at query time with the unpack_json pipe . 2. Promtail will reach an End-of-Life (EOL) on March 2, 2026. The example log line generated by Promtail example extracting data from json log. Instead, you'll want to parse the JSON at query time using LogQL. Is it possile to parse first part of the log as json, and for stack-trace make new label This section is a collection of all stages Promtail supports in a Pipeline. Because of these design differences, having too many indexes can end up hurting Loki's performance. This section is a collection of all stages Promtail supports in a Pipeline. The container i'm getting the logs from outputs them in JSON format i. e. yaml Promtail example configuration for Loki. 3 I've created some monitoring with grafana, loki and promtail. It discovers targets, attaches labels to log Promtail client library. The json stage is a parsing stage that reads the log line as JSON Web Token (JWT) is a compact URL-safe means of representing claims to be transferred between two parties. 1,$ {VAR} 环境变量的使用仍有问题,具体表现为必须 Support for compressed files Promtail now has native support for ingesting compressed files. The claims in a JWT are encoded as a Promtail is configured in a YAML file (usually referred to as config. Should I get rid it before sending it to the pipe and parse? So can somebody We would like to show you a description here but the site won’t allow us. yjeok psi olghm elsjh lwnn mgyxufw hsjdxww utxmffpv pxc bhag